Also considered
Brands AI Didn't Consistently Recommend
During our cross-platform analysis, several major brands and institutional entities surfaced frequently in search results but were explicitly bypassed by AI systems as top recommendations for collision repair. Here is why the consensus points away from them.
- Tesla & Dealership Body ShopsAI Report ›
While AI acknowledges that dealerships (like Tesla, BMW, and Honda) have the ultimate factory knowledge, they consistently warn against using them for standard collision repair due to notoriously long wait times, higher labor rates, and poor communication compared to certified independent shops.
- State Farm & GEICO Direct Repair NetworksAI Report ›
Major insurers often push customers toward their 'Direct Repair Program' (DRP) shops. AI consensus highlights a conflict of interest here: DRP shops are contractually pressured to use cheaper aftermarket parts to save the insurer money, whereas independent certified shops fight to use safer OEM parts for the consumer.
How to choose
Best Collision Repair Shops of 2026 Buying Guide
Choosing the right collision center dictates the safety, resale value, and longevity of your vehicle. Based on expert consensus and AI data, here are the critical factors to evaluate before handing over your keys.
01
Understanding OEM vs. Aftermarket Parts
Demand factory-grade materials.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) parts are designed specifically by your vehicle's maker, ensuring a perfect fit and crash-test reliability. Many insurance policies attempt to mandate cheaper, generic aftermarket parts to cut their own costs. According to Dealership vs Independent Body Shops: Pros & Cons, independent shops that strongly advocate for OEM parts provide a distinct safety advantage, restoring your vehicle to its true factory standard.
02
Navigating Insurance Direct Repair Programs (DRPs)
You have the legal right to choose. Your insurance adjuster will almost certainly recommend a shop from their Direct Repair Program network, implying the process will be faster. While insurers like State Farm vet these shops, DRP facilities often agree to use aftermarket parts to maintain their preferred status. You are never legally obligated to use the insurer's recommended shop, and choosing a strong independent facility ensures the shop works for you, not the carrier.
03
The Importance of Manufacturer Certifications
Look for I-CAR and OEM badges. The complexity of modern vehicles requires continuous technician training. An I-CAR Gold Class certification is the baseline for a competent shop, indicating ongoing education in structural repair. Manufacturer-specific certifications (like those held heavily by Alioto's Auto Body) mean the shop has purchased the exact proprietary tools, welding equipment, and software required by brands like Ford, Honda, or BMW to safely repair their specific chassis.
04
Handling Structural Frame Damage
Laser precision is non-negotiable. A major collision often compromises the hidden structural frame of the car. Top-rated shops use computerized, laser-guided frame measuring systems to pull the chassis back to within millimeters of factory specifications. If a shop relies purely on visual estimates or outdated mechanical pulling racks, your vehicle's alignment and future crash safety could be permanently compromised.
05
Electric Vehicle (EV) Specific Repairs
High-voltage systems require specialists. EVs like Teslas, Rivians, and modern hybrids cannot be repaired like traditional gas vehicles. They feature high-voltage battery arrays that pose severe fire risks and often utilize lightweight aluminum frames that require specialized clean-room welding environments. If you drive an EV, you must verify that the shop holds specific EV certifications and has the isolation bays necessary to handle aluminum dust safely.
06
Warranties and Post-Repair Guarantees
Insist on a lifetime guarantee. A reputable collision center will stand behind its craftsmanship for as long as you own the vehicle. This covers issues like paint peeling, clear coat fading, or misaligned panels that might not become obvious until months after the repair. Always secure the lifetime warranty in writing before authorizing the final insurance payout to the shop.
Common questions
Frequently Asked Questions
Do I have to use the auto body shop my insurance company recommends?
No, you have the legal right to choose any collision repair shop you prefer. Insurance companies often suggest their 'Direct Repair Program' shops because those facilities have agreed to discounted rates and the use of aftermarket parts. Choosing an independent certified shop ensures the technicians are prioritizing your vehicle's safety and OEM standards over the insurer's budget.
How long does collision repair take in San Francisco?
Collision repair in San Francisco typically takes anywhere from 3 days for minor bumper scuffs to over 4 weeks for major structural damage. The timeline is heavily dictated by supply chain delays for OEM parts and the speed at which your insurance company approves supplemental repair estimates. Highly rated shops will provide a target delivery date only after tearing down the vehicle to assess hidden damage.
Will a collision repair shop help cover my insurance deductible?
Reputable auto body shops do not generally waive or cover your insurance deductible, as doing so is often considered insurance fraud. However, some independent shops may work with you on the cost of out-of-pocket non-insurance repairs or offer financing options. Always be wary of a shop promising to 'bury' the deductible in the claim, as this requires inflating the repair bill illegally.
Can auto body shops fix underlying structural frame damage?
Yes, qualified collision centers are fully equipped to repair structural frame damage using computerized laser-measuring systems. These machines allow technicians to anchor the vehicle and hydraulically pull the crumpled steel or aluminum back to exact factory specifications. If the frame is bent beyond safe structural limits, a certified shop will declare the vehicle a total loss rather than risk your safety.
What is the difference between an I-CAR Gold Class shop and others?
An I-CAR Gold Class certification means the shop requires its technicians to undergo rigorous, continuous training on the latest vehicle materials and repair techniques. Because modern cars increasingly use high-strength steel, aluminum, and complex safety sensors, older repair methods can actually make the vehicle unsafe. Gold Class status is the industry's highest benchmark for up-to-date technical competence.
Do I need to get multiple estimates after a car accident?
You do not legally need to get multiple estimates, though doing so can provide peace of mind if you are paying out-of-pocket. If you are going through insurance, the carrier will usually send their own adjuster or ask for photos to generate a baseline estimate. Once you select a shop, the facility will tear down the car, find any hidden damage, and negotiate directly with the insurance company for the final cost.
How do I know if the shop is using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) parts?
You can verify the use of OEM parts by reviewing the itemized repair estimate and the final invoice provided by the shop. The estimate will explicitly code parts as 'OEM', 'Aftermarket', 'A/M', or 'LKQ' (Like Kind and Quality/Salvage). You should explicitly tell both the shop manager and your insurance adjuster that you expect OEM parts to be used for all structural and safety-related components.
Does fixing a Tesla require a special body shop?
Yes, repairing a Tesla requires a shop that has been explicitly certified by the Tesla Approved Body Shop Network. Teslas utilize high-voltage battery systems, complex Autopilot sensor suites, and specialized aluminum casting that cannot be safely repaired using traditional steel welding techniques. Taking a Tesla to an uncertified shop can void the warranty and compromise the vehicle's structural integrity.
